Study abroad
- As a student of our university, you can take part in the Erasmus+ programme.
- Under this programme, you can study abroad for 1 or 2 semesters.
- You can choose from 14 partner universities.
- Your stay abroad can be partially funded.
Internships abroad
- Internships last 2–12 months.
- Recruitment runs all year.
- You can receive a scholarship to offset living costs abroad.
- You gain professional experience and improve your foreign language.

Advance from Bachelor’s to Master’s in the USA with Franklin University
Exchange program between WSB Merito University and Franklin University allows students to complete a bachelor’s degree in Poland and then study in the USA to earn an American master’s in fields like Business Analytics, Computer Science, Health Informatics, or Information Technology. Participants gain international academic experience, structured support with admissions and the F-1 visa process.
How to start studying abroad?
Criteria to meet
To apply for a mobility under Erasmus+, you must:
- be a student of first-cycle, second-cycle (bachelor’s, engineering, master’s) or long-cycle master’s studies at WSB Merito University,
- have completed the first year of first-cycle (bachelor’s) or long-cycle master’s studies; remember that you cannot go abroad in the last semester of your studies,
- be a citizen of a country participating in Erasmus+ (or have refugee status or a permanent residence card in a participating country).
Recruitment process
- Checking your knowledge of the foreign language in which classes are conducted abroad (spoken and written).
- Verifying your grade point average from your entire period of study at our university.
- Signing the required documents (learning agreement and the contract for the mobility and scholarship).
